How To Protect Yourself From Deepfake-Based UPI Frauds

Be cautious of video calls or messages from unknown numbers claiming to be acquaintances suddenly

Verify the person's identity twice before handing over money for high-urgency transactions always

Share minimal personal data, photos, and videos online to prevent realistic deepfake creation effectively

Use strict privacy settings on social media to limit publicly available information about yourself always

Enable additional verification steps within your UPI app, such as app-based PINs or biometrics securely

Watch for abnormal face movements, lip-sync problems, or irregular blinking in video calls carefully

Detect strange pauses, robotic-sounding voice, or off-key background noises in voice calls immediately

Be wary of individuals demanding cash payment immediately without allowing authentication or verification steps

Report suspected deepfake UPI fraud to your bank's fraud helpline and cybercrime.gov.in simultaneously always

Sensitize colleagues, relatives, and friends about deepfake dangers to prevent falling victim to scams effectively
